AI Agents Arrive On The Scene

Perhaps the emerging AI technology that guarantees the most radical shift in how people experience their regional government will be through the implementation of AI agents. An AI representative is a system that acts individually to process details and after that take actions to achieve particular objectives. Instead of a person providing AI with the exact actions required to get something done, the promise of an AI representative is that it can identify the optimum steps and after that tackle getting them done.

The group behind SuperCity included significant government and technology credentials. Miguel Gamiño Jr., no complete stranger to city management having actually served previously as the head of innovation in the cities of El Paso, San Francisco, and New York, has joined forces with his two partners, David Lara, formerly the Chief Administrative Officer at New York City Town Hall, and Niko Dubovsky, who's operated in the start-up world for numerous years.

The group's enthusiasm for civil service together with a deep understanding of how cities work are properties that they are bringing to constructing this solution. This coupled with cutting edge AI adoption does not guarantee their success but certainly supplies them with some early advantages.

Their mission with SuperCity is to offer a protected and personal digital one-stop-shop for homeowners and to utilize AI to decrease various aspects of friction between the user, the app, and town hall. That friction ranges from locals who are overwhelmed with unneeded alerts to the intricacy of supporting the required interfaces with firm systems. For example, rather than the city being required to manage the complex combination of accepting payments from the app for say, a parking ticket, SuperCity uses AI to satisfy city requirements and then perfectly log in and send the payment.

Removing the complexity for both the user and the city likewise implies that this single app can be used in various cities without needing the user to download a brand-new app with an entirely various procedure.

While a lot of apps require the user to locate the feature they need, SuperCity will quickly emerge as a conversational bot. A resident will just discuss what they require and the app will use AI representatives to bring out as much of the need with little, if any, user engagement.
